What is Gluten and What Foods Contain It?

Gluten is a protein found in certain grains such as wheat, barley, and rye. It is often used as a binding agent and can be found in a wide variety of foods, including bread, pasta, flour-based desserts, and candy bars.

How to Confirm if a Food is Gluten-Free

Confirming whether a food is gluten-free can be tricky. The easiest way to tell is to look for gluten-free labeling on the packaging. If the food does not have any labeling, check the ingredient list for any grains such as wheat, barley, rye, or malt extract/malt flavoring.

If you are still unsure, contact the manufacturer or do some research online to see if the food is gluten-free or not.

Understanding Gluten-Free Labeling Regulations and Requirements

According to the FDA, a food item can only be labeled “gluten-free” if it contains less than 20 parts per million of gluten. This applies to manufacturers who voluntarily label their products as “gluten-free”.
